Apparently most of the Christmas packs and stock, ie Fullers Vintage Ale, will not be listed online until after Remembrance Day as a mark of respect. Fullers Vintage Ale is out in select stores now. By the way the LCBO has messed up the Imperial Stout calling it Fullers Brewers Reserve Imperial Stout. Fullers has only brewed 5 Brewers Reserve ales so far and they are listed as 1-5 and there is NO imperial stout. They are all beers that were cask conditioned in sherry, whisky,cognac etc barrels.
